Job Description

About the Team

Our Wolt Real Estate & Facilities team is a crucial function within the Wolt Finance org and manages the planning acquiring fitting out and and running of our office portfolio across 33 countries. 

As Portfolio Lease Administrator youll be a vital part of a team that  manages our full lease portfolio and enables the dynamic continued growth of Wolts Real Estate. Youll be reporting to the Global Head of Real Estate & Facilities and be responsible for the management and reporting on lease obligations directly as well as through vendors. 

 

Role background

 Its an exciting time to be part of our team  as this is our first in house Portfolio Lease Administration role and you will get the opportunity to truly shape the way our processes run. As Portfolio Lease Administrator you will manage all lease obligations and support the scaling of our diverse real estate portfolio as we expand and evolve to support our business. You will need to be a master at handling multiple tasks and projects with a nojobistoosmall attitude an ability to take thoughtful initiative and the desire to go above and beyond. You will ensure compliance in lease reporting auditing and approving lease abstractions assist with portfolio planning and other ongoing portfolio management activities. This role will require exceptional communication skills organisational skills strong attention to detail resourcefulness and the ability to work well with a diverse range of cross functional partners.

 

What youll be doing

  • Be a critical team member in the management of our expanding global portfolio including tracking critical dates and driving strategic real estate decisions.
  • Review and approve new lease/amendment abstractions to ensure 100% accuracy in our lease database and administration system. 
  • Partner with our Construction Management team to ensure recovery of all TIA.
  • Work closely with Lease Accounting to ensure full reporting compliance. 
  • Work with Landlords Transaction Management and Construction teams on assorted postlease documentation including commencement date agreements TIAs deposit and guarantee tracking. 
  • Coordinate sublease projects.
  • Provide ownership responsibilities to the Facilities team per each Lease.
  • Work with legal to issue notices to Landlords and Lease Accounting to issue invoices applicable to the Lease language.
  • Interact with Landlords in order to facilitate completion of paperwork required under the Lease and walk them through the provisions if necessary.
  • Establish timely deadlines with the Landlord for selfhelp rights if not established in the lease and inform Facilities of expectations.
  • Monitor and collect reimbursements from Landlords for lease cap selfhelp and security deposits.
  • Work alongside internal and external audit teams to ensure a seamless and successful audit process.
  • Foster strong relationships with crossfunctional partners and ensure alignment across the organization.
  • Provide accurate and timely critical date reporting for lease/option renewals terminations and other key milestones.
  • Partner and hold our third party vendor accountable to the reconciliation of monthly payments.
  • Partner with our third party vendor as needed to research and resolve payment disputes with Landlords.
  • Liaise with lease accounting lease technology team and our third party team.
  • Support the preparation of monthly portfolio metric reporting.
  • Support special projects and assignments as required.
  • Develop and maintain process playbooks.
  • Review and audit CAM / service charge reconciliations.
  • Maintain portfolio asset tracker and execute documentation.

Qualifications :

  • A strong understanding of lease agreements terminology lease accounting principles. 
  • Multiyear experience managing an international real estate portfolio. You bring expertise and understanding of commercial leases including extensive exposure to office and commercial portfolios. 
  • Expertise in understanding and interpreting complex lease language and CAM / service  charges
  • Proficiency with lease database tools (we currently use leasecalcs). 
  • Understanding of legal terminology as it pertains to leases and real estate
  • Ability to understand abstract and communicate lease requirements to stakeholders
  • Excellent written verbal analytical and research skills required in English
  • LeaseCalc Google Suite experience a plus as are relevant industry degrees and qualifications.
